Can a Nice Jewish Girl Enjoy a Naughty Nosh?

So, I'm a radical feminist who opposes the institution of marriage.

Not to mention a pescetarian who hasn't eaten meat since the Carter administration.

Which means it might surprise you that I whipped up this little illustration a couple weeks back.
But really, it's not all that mind-boggling. Or at least no more mind-boggling than the fact that, thanks to me, the Jew and the Carrot, a blog dedicated to the intersection of Jews, food, and sustainability, now links to the Marriage Bed, a discussion board chock full o' sex tips for fundamentalist Christians.

Epi-ethicurious how that came to pass? I thought you might be.

All the Blogs I've Been Writing For, Which Is Why I Haven't Been Writing Here


It's official.

I am a yenta.

Yes, in the fine tradition of Abigail Van Buren, Ann Landers, and Dan Savage, I am now the author of an advice column.

Unlike Bea Arthur, however, I am not Yenta the Matchmaker. Or at least, I am not Yenta Who Guarantees You a Nice Jewish Boy.

I am actually the most exogamous Jew on the planet.

Okay, maybe I could be a little more exogamous. For example, I'm not married to the Pope.

But I am now apparently, in addition to being the Dear Abby of the Appetizers, a recognized expert on interfaith relationships. Because the editor of Interfaith Family read my earlier post on the Jew and the Carrot, then started reading this blog, from which she figured out I was shtupping a goy, and thus asked me to write an article for Interfaith Family.

Most of the articles on Interfaith Family are very serious. They are about things like how to find a clergy person to perform your wedding (my solution: just live in sin!) or how to prep your goyishe in-laws for their supporting role in your son's bris (my solution: when it comes to genital-related incisions, a vasectomy nips the whole problem of what to do with the kids in the bud, as it were).

Yes, Interfaith Family takes on some serious issues. My solution? Write an article showing why really it's way easier to be in an intefaith relationship than, G-d forbid, to marry a Jew.

Because Jews are a big pain in the observance.
